Blockchain Technology and Privacy Coins

At the heart of Privacy Coin DAOs is blockchain technology—a distributed ledger that records all transactions across a network of computers. This technology ensures transparency, security, and immutability, forming the backbone of cryptocurrencies.

Privacy Coins enhance this technology by incorporating privacy-preserving features. Here are some key privacy technologies used in Privacy Coins:

Zero-Knowledge Proofs (ZKPs): These cryptographic protocols allow one party to prove to another that a certain statement is true without revealing any additional information. ZKPs are used to verify transactions without exposing details like amounts or sender/receiver addresses.

Confidential Transactions: This technology ensures that transaction amounts are hidden from observers on the blockchain. It maintains privacy by masking the amount transferred in each transaction.

Ring Signatures: In a ring signature, a user can sign a transaction using a group of public keys, making it impossible to determine which key was actually used. This provides anonymity by obscuring the identity of the transaction's creator.

Mix Nets: A mix net shuffles transactions to obscure the sender and receiver, providing anonymity by making it difficult to trace the origin of a transaction.

Governance Mechanisms in Privacy Coin DAOs

Governance in Privacy Coin DAOs revolves around how decisions are made and how power is distributed among members. Here are the key governance mechanisms:

Token-Based Voting: Members hold tokens that grant them voting power. The number of tokens correlates with the voting weight. For example, holding more tokens means having more influence over decisions.

Proposal System: Any member can submit a proposal for changes or new initiatives. The proposal is then reviewed and discussed within the community before voting.

Delegation: Instead of directly voting, members can delegate their voting power to trusted representatives. This can simplify governance for large DAOs with many participants.

Quadratic Voting: This mechanism allows members to distribute their votes in a way that gives more weight to less popular proposals. It aims to ensure that all voices are heard, regardless of their popularity.
